Which is cheaper, College of Southern Nevada or Carrington College-Las Vegas?

College of Southern Nevada, at $6,615 a year after aid versus $43,570 — a gap of $36,955 a year, or $73,910 across the full degree. These are net prices after grants and scholarships, not sticker prices, so they reflect what an aided student pays.

Do College of Southern Nevada or Carrington College-Las Vegas graduates earn more?

College of Southern Nevada graduates report a median $38,087 ten years after entry, $1,369 more than the $36,718 at Carrington College-Las Vegas. Both are institution-wide medians from federal tax records, so a high-paying major at the lower school can beat the average at the higher one.

Which leaves students with less debt, College of Southern Nevada or Carrington College-Las Vegas?

College of Southern Nevada: its completers carry a median $8,000 in federal loans versus $9,500 at Carrington College-Las Vegas, a difference of $1,500. The figure counts students who finished; it excludes private loans and anyone who left before graduating.

Which graduates more of its students?

59% of students finish at Carrington College-Las Vegas, against 19% at College of Southern Nevada. Completion matters to the ROI arithmetic because a degree that is never finished still carries its cost and its debt, but earns none of the graduate premium above the $48,360 high-school baseline.
